Développement d'applications de rencontres sociales : comment créer une expérience utilisateur réussie
Colas Mérand
03/02/2025
développement d'applications
applications de rencontres
UX/UI
5 minutes
Colas Mérand
03/02/2025
développement d'applications
applications de rencontres
UX/UI
5 minutes
Développement d'applications de rencontres sociales : comment créer une expérience utilisateur réussie
Dans un monde de plus en plus connecté mais paradoxalement marqué par l'isolement social, les applications de rencontres connaissent un essor considérable. Au-delà des applications de dating traditionnelles, une nouvelle tendance émerge : les plateformes de rencontres sociales en groupe, permettant de créer des liens autour d'activités partagées. Cet article explore les aspects essentiels à considérer lors du développement d'une telle application, des fonctionnalités clés aux défis techniques.
Les fonctionnalités essentielles d'une application de rencontres sociales
1. Sélection d'activités diversifiées
La première étape pour créer une application de rencontres sociales réussie consiste à proposer un large éventail d'activités. Qu'il s'agisse de sorties au restaurant, d'activités sportives, de balades en plein air ou d'événements culturels, la diversité est essentielle pour attirer différents profils d'utilisateurs.
Notre expérience avec plusieurs clients nous a montré que les utilisateurs apprécient particulièrement la possibilité de filtrer les activités selon leurs centres d'intérêt. Une catégorisation claire et intuitive des activités facilite la navigation et améliore l'engagement des utilisateurs.
2. Algorithme de mise en relation intelligent
Le cœur d'une application de rencontres sociales réside dans son algorithme de mise en relation. Pour créer des groupes harmonieux (généralement de 4 à 6 personnes), plusieurs facteurs doivent être pris en compte :
- Les centres d'intérêt communs
- La compatibilité des personnalités
- La proximité géographique
- Les disponibilités horaires
Un algorithme bien conçu doit trouver le juste équilibre entre aléatoire (pour favoriser les découvertes) et pertinence (pour maximiser les chances de connexions réussies).
3. Système de rendez-vous efficace
La gestion des rendez-vous est cruciale pour une expérience utilisateur fluide. L'application doit proposer :
- Un calendrier intuitif pour la sélection des dates
- Des notifications de rappel
- Des options de modification ou d'annulation
- La possibilité de suggérer des horaires alternatifs
Lors du développement de la plateforme Epictory, nous avons implémenté un système de planification avancé qui a considérablement amélioré l'engagement des utilisateurs. Cette expérience nous a permis de comprendre l'importance d'une interface de planification claire et réactive.
4. Modèle économique et système d'abonnement
Pour assurer la viabilité d'une application de rencontres sociales, un modèle économique solide est nécessaire. Les options les plus courantes incluent :
- Un modèle freemium avec fonctionnalités de base gratuites
- Des abonnements mensuels ou annuels pour des fonctionnalités premium
- Des achats in-app pour des boosts ou des fonctionnalités spéciales
Notre expérience avec des plateformes comme Dealt et Astory nous a permis d'affiner notre approche en matière d'intégration de systèmes de paiement sécurisés et d'optimisation des taux de conversion.
Les défis techniques du développement
Architecture technique robuste
Le développement d'une application de rencontres sociales nécessite une architecture technique solide capable de gérer :
- Des pics d'utilisation (notamment en soirée et le week-end)
- Le traitement en temps réel des données pour les mises en relation
- La sécurité des données personnelles des utilisateurs
- La scalabilité pour accompagner la croissance de l'application
Une stack technologique moderne comme celle que nous avons utilisée pour Easop (NextJS, TypeScript, PostgreSQL) offre la flexibilité et la performance nécessaires pour ce type d'application.
Conception UX/UI centrée utilisateur
L'interface utilisateur d'une application de rencontres sociales doit être particulièrement soignée pour faciliter l'adoption et fidéliser les utilisateurs. Les principes clés incluent :
- Une navigation intuitive entre les différentes sections
- Des formulaires de profil simples mais complets
- Une visualisation claire des activités et des groupes
- Un design responsive adapté à tous les appareils
Notre collaboration avec le Centre Pompidou pour le développement d'une application interactive nous a permis d'affiner notre approche en matière de design centré utilisateur, en créant des interfaces à la fois esthétiques et fonctionnelles.
Sécurité et confidentialité
La sécurité est primordiale dans une application qui gère des données personnelles et organise des rencontres physiques. Les mesures essentielles comprennent :
- L'authentification sécurisée des utilisateurs
- Le chiffrement des données sensibles
- La vérification des profils
- Des systèmes de signalement d'utilisateurs problématiques
- La conformité au RGPD et autres réglementations sur la protection des données
Stratégies pour le lancement et la croissance
Tests utilisateurs approfondis
Avant le lancement, des tests utilisateurs approfondis sont essentiels pour identifier les problèmes potentiels et affiner l'expérience. Nous recommandons :
- Des tests A/B sur différentes versions de l'interface
- Des groupes de discussion pour recueillir des retours qualitatifs
- Des périodes de bêta-test avec un groupe restreint d'utilisateurs
Stratégie d'acquisition d'utilisateurs
Le succès d'une application de rencontres sociales dépend de sa capacité à atteindre une masse critique d'utilisateurs. Une stratégie d'acquisition efficace peut inclure :
- Des partenariats avec des lieux d'activités (restaurants, salles de sport, etc.)
- Une stratégie de marketing de contenu ciblée
- Des campagnes sur les réseaux sociaux
- Un programme de parrainage incitatif
Lors du lancement du site du Festival Ouaille Note, nous avons mis en place une stratégie SEO performante qui a généré un trafic organique significatif dès les premiers mois. Ces techniques peuvent être adaptées pour promouvoir une application de rencontres sociales.
Analyse de données et amélioration continue
L'analyse des données d'utilisation est cruciale pour l'amélioration continue de l'application. Les métriques clés à surveiller incluent :
- Le taux de conversion des inscriptions
- Le taux de participation aux activités
- La fréquence d'utilisation
- Le taux de rétention des utilisateurs
- Les retours après les rencontres
Conclusion
Le développement d'une application de rencontres sociales représente un défi technique et créatif passionnant. En combinant une architecture technique robuste, une expérience utilisateur soignée et des fonctionnalités innovantes, il est possible de créer une plateforme qui répond véritablement aux besoins de connexion sociale de ses utilisateurs.
Chez Platane, nous avons développé une expertise particulière dans la création d'applications sociales innovantes, en alliant technologies de pointe et design centré utilisateur. Notre approche intègre les dernières avancées en matière d'intelligence artificielle pour optimiser les algorithmes de mise en relation et améliorer l'expérience globale.
Vous avez un projet d'application sociale innovante ? Nous serions ravis d'échanger sur votre vision et de vous accompagner dans sa réalisation. Prenez rendez-vous via notre formulaire de contact pour discuter de votre projet avec notre équipe d'experts. Ensemble, transformons votre idée en une application performante qui crée de véritables connexions humaines.
Comment créer une plateforme de mise en relation performante : l'exemple du cake design
Comment réintégrer efficacement les avis Google sur votre site web : Guide complet
Développement d'applications de recrutement cross-platform : enjeux et solutions pour connecter entreprises et talents
N'hésitez pas à nous contacter.
Nous aussi et c'est évidemment sans engagement !